Social Phobia
An anxiety disorder characterized by a significant fear of being embarrassed, judged, or scrutinized by others in social or performance situations.
Obsessions
Persistent, intrusive thoughts, images, or urges that cause significant anxiety or distress.
Compulsions
Repetitive behaviors or mental acts that an individual feels driven to perform, often in response to an obsession or according to rigidly applied rules.
Cognitive Errors
Mistakes in reasoning, evaluating, remembering, or other cognitive processes that can lead to inaccurate judgments or decisions.
